摘  要:危险化学品管理是高校实验室安全管理工作的一项重要内容之一,是保障实验教学、科学研究顺利开展的基础。对于地方综合性大学,危险化学品的科学管理有其特殊性。学校按照"严把源头,规范过程,加快处置,实时监控,事前预警,监管到人"的原则,开发危险化学品全过程管理系统,实现从化学品购置到危废物处置的全生命周期监管和全痕迹管理;同时利用大数据云计算,充分挖掘基础数据,预测潜在风险,为管理部门决策提供依据。该管理模式已在我校取得了很好的效果,可为其他高校危险化学品管理提供参考。The management of dangerous chemicals is the basis of ensuring the smooth development of experimental teaching and scientific research,as well as one of the important contents of laboratory safety management in colleges and universities. For local comprehensive universities, the scientific management of dangerous chemicals has its particularity. In accordance with the principles,including "strictly sourcing,standardizing the process,accelerating disposal,real-time monitoring,prior warning,and supervision to people",we develop a full process management system for dangerous chemicals to achieve full life cycle monitoring and full trace management from chemical purchase to dangerous waste disposal. At the same time,we make full use of big data cloud computing to mine basic data,so that the system can predict potential risks and provide a basis for management decision-making. This management model has achieved good results in Shanxi University,and can provide reference for the management of dangerous chemicals in other universities.
